A 4-man team-play event, playing 4 different formats (2 of which are match pay) and 3 different layouts on the Stoney Hill course. Decidedly not your run-of-the-mill 11-division stroke-play tournament on your local public course.

There'll be campfires and match-play upsets and dozens of lost discs and boasts, and at least a thousand dollars raised for The Children's Heart Foundation.

A little story, not so much about this event, as an encouragement to others out there who might want to go out on the edge a little bit:

In 2013, we decided to abandon the traditional format event we'd been running in October, and offer our disc golf community something different, team play, with a variety of playing formats (match play, etc.). That year, 24 players showed up---about a third of whom were family members. We thought long and hard, and decided to give it one more try before giving up. In 2014, we doubled attendance to 12 teams. In 2015, we filled, right at the last minute. In 2016, we filled and had to turn away a couple of teams. In 2017, we filled in 16 days, still 7 weeks to go.

So, folks, if you think you have a great idea and it flops at first, maybe give it another shot before abandoning it.
